Significant differences between arborio rice and cheesecake
- Arborio rice has more vitamin B1, iron, folate, and manganese; however, cheesecake is richer in vitamin B2, vitamin A, and phosphorus.
- Cheesecake covers your daily saturated fat needs 49% more than arborio rice.
- Cheesecake has 6 times less vitamin B1 than arborio rice. Arborio rice has 0.164mg of vitamin B1, while cheesecake has 0.028mg.
- Arborio rice contains less saturated fat.
- Arborio rice has a higher glycemic index. The glycemic index of arborio rice is 69, while the glycemic index of cheesecake is 50.
Specific food types used in this comparison are Rice, white, short-grain, enriched, cooked and Cheesecake commercially prepared.
